Pink Annabelle is a beautiful hydrangea variety that is known for its large, 6-inch-wide, round clusters of pink flowers. It is a relatively easy plant to care for and can be grown in full sun or partial shade. Pink Annabelle is hardy in USDA zones 3-9 and can grow to be 4-6 feet tall and wide.
